Overview
- On June 20, Zara Tindall arrived for day four of Royal Ascot in a pastel blue Veronica Beard two-piece featuring a relaxed single-breasted blazer and wide-legged trousers.
- She layered the ensemble over a luxe blue silk shirt and finished the look with a matching fascinator, aquamarine drop earrings, a white leather clutch and suede blue pumps.
- Earlier in the week she turned heads in a cornflower blue Rebecca Vallance lace midi, a sold-out Anna Mason floral dress and a black-and-white Laura Green fit-and-flare A-line.
- Attendees at the Berkshire racing festival must comply with strict dress codes that call for coordinated dresses or suits and mandatory hats or headpieces.
- Other royal figures at Ascot this week included the King, Camilla, Princess Anne, Princess Eugenie and the Duchess of York, all showcasing refined race day fashion.
